News: Gravitational Waves: Theory and Methods for Detection

Our first Advanced Track Lecture Series installment took place in mid-February. The topic was “Gravitational Waves: Theory and Methods for Detection” and was presented by Dr. Deyan Mihaylov, a post-doctoral researcher at the Max Planck Institute. A live question and answer session with Dr. Mihaylov followed the main presentation. Advanced Track lectures are appropriate for university students and attendees with an advanced knowledge of science and maths. You can learn more about the lecture, and view the webinar video, here.
